Where did internet radio go in itunes?

Where did internet radio go in itunes? In the iTunes app on your PC, choose Music from the pop-up menu at the top left, then click Library. Click Internet Radio in the sidebar on the left.

What happened to Internet radio in iTunes? Answer: A: Internet Radio is still available in iTunes 12.7. There is a hidden Edit command for the menu, to the right of the word Library, in the same place as Done in the image below.

Where did my radio go on Apple Music? On your iPhone, iPad, iPod touch, Mac, Apple TV, Apple Watch, Android device, or Chromebook: Open the Apple Music app and go to the Radio tab. On your HomePod: Ask Siri to play a radio station. On your PC: Open iTunes, choose Music from the pop-up menu, then click Radio in the navigation bar.

How do I listen to Internet radio on my Mac? When you know the exact URL of an internet broadcast or audio file, Music can connect to it directly and you can stream it over the internet. In the Music app on your Mac, choose File > Open Stream URL.

What is legal limit in us for ham radio?

At all times, transmitter power must be the minimum necessary to carry out the desired communications. Unless otherwise noted, the maximum power output is 1500 watts PEP. Novice/Technicians are limited to 200 watts PEP on HF bands.

Do people still listen to the radio?

In America, 92% of the population still listens to radio every week, approximately 272 million people. This is ahead of the 87% that consume television on a weekly basis and far beyond the 22% who listen to podcasts weekly.

How far does the north dakota radio mast transmit?

The tower provides a broadcast area of roughly 9,700 square miles (25,000 km2), which is a radius of about 55.6 miles (89.5 km). Due to the spectrum repack, KVLY transmits on UHF channel 36 and maps to virtual channel 11 through PSIP.

Do car radios fit all cars?

Universal car stereos will fit any car, provided you’ve understood the difference between single DIN and double DIN car stereos and have the correct fascia panel. Ensuring that you’ve equipped the right fascia panel should allow you to seamlessly install your universal car stereo into almost any vehicle’s interior.

What frequency is radio caroline on?

After a successful application to Ofcom, Radio Caroline has been given the medium wave frequency of 648kHz – once used by the BBC World Service.

When was the first radio transmission made?

It is generally recognized that the first radio transmission was made from a temporary station set up by Guglielmo Marconi in 1895 on the Isle of Wight. This followed on from pioneering work in the field by a number of people including Alessandro Volta, André-Marie Ampère, Georg Ohm and James Clerk Maxwell.

Are there limits to what songs radio can play?

In the United States, the answer is no. No songs are banned from being played on the radio here. That’s just not a concept that exists here as it might in some other countries. That said, there are some songs that you’ll never hear on terrestrial (non-satellite) radio in unedited form, except perhaps late at night.

What channel is classical music on sirius satellite radio?

Symphony Hall is a Sirius XM Radio station featuring exclusively classical music. It is located on Sirius XM Radio channel 76 and DISH Network channel 6076.

Where are radio waves on the electromagnetic spectrum?

radio wave, wave from the portion of the electromagnetic spectrum at lower frequencies than microwaves. The wavelengths of radio waves range from thousands of metres to 30 cm. These correspond to frequencies as low as 3 Hz and as high as 1 gigahertz (109 Hz).

How do radio stations get rights to music?

Most internet-only radio station’s cover themselves by paying for what’s known as a “blanket license” or “umbrella license”. These cover their stations and allow them to play any type of copyrighted music.
